WebFirst Stage of Cyclic Theory The society is in the stage of growth, the individuals are not fully united and the creative leadership is emerging. The people have primary group relations in most of their daily situations. There is no regular military force and an established state. There is solidarity and unity among the members of society. Web36 The American Catholic Sociological Review cycle, the social institution cycle of Chapin and Ogburn, and theories of rhythmic and cyclical changes in civilization presented by … Social cycle theories are among the earliest social theories in sociology. Unlike the theory of social evolutionism, which views the evolution of society and human history as progressing in some new, unique direction(s), sociological cycle theory argues that events and stages of society and history generally repeat … See more Interpretation of history as repeating cycles of Dark and Golden Ages was a common belief among ancient cultures. Kyklos (Ancient Greek: κύκλος [kýklos], "cycle") is a term used by some classical Greek authors to describe … See more Thomas Carlyle (1795–1881) conceived of history as though it were a phoenix, growing and dying in stages akin to the seasons.
